In Valheim, choosing between a Tower Shield and a Round Shield depends on your playstyle and the challenges you face. Tower Shields are large, heavy shields that excel at blocking incoming damage but lack the ability to parry. Round Shields, on the other hand, are lighter and allow for parrying, mak...
